Ivan Trickovski made his Champions League debut for APOEL, Martin Bogatinov kept a clean sheet for Karpaty Lviv, while Goran Popov was serving a one game suspension for Dynamo Kyiv.
UEFA Champions League, Third qualifying round, Dynamo Kyiv – Rubin Kazan 0:2
Goran Popov did not play for Dynamo Kyiv as he was serving a one game suspension for picking up a red card during last season’s Europa League match against Braga. That red card carried into this season and since that was the last European competition match played by Dynamo Kyiv, Popov had to serve his suspension in this game. Dynamo Kyiv suffered a disappointing home loss against Rubin Kazan and faces a daunting challenge in the return leg to avoid an early elimination from the competition.
UEFA Champions League, Third qualifying round, APOEL – Slovan Bratislava 0:0
Ivan Trickovski started on the bench for APOEL before he entered the game in the 72nd minute replacing Aldo Adorno. Trickovski had a good chance in the 75th minute but his shot with his weaker left foot from a good position went wide of the goal.

UEFA Champions League, Third qualifying round, Maccabi Haifa – Maribor 2:1
Agim Ibraimi played the entire game for Maribor and contributed on the only goal for his team in the 27th minute. Ibraimi made a nice dribble before he passed the ball to Dejan Mezga who then found Marcos Tavares whose nice shot went past the opposing keeper.
UEFA Europa League, Third qualifying round, Mainz 05 – Gaz Metan Mediaș 1:1
Nikolce Noveski played all 90 minutes for Mainz who were held to a disappointing draw against Gaz Metan Mediaș. The visitors scored their lone goal in the 60th minute following a free kick which ended up in the crowded penalty area and the ball found a visiting player who slotted a shot past the Mainz keeper.
UEFA Europa League, Third qualifying round, Karpaty Lviv – St Patrick’s 2:0
Martin Bogatinov played from the start for Karpaty Lviv and kept a clean sheet. Bogatinov wasn’t tested much and only had to make one difficult save in the 63rd minute when he denied Derek Doyle.

UEFA Europa League, Third qualifying round, Levski – Spartak Trnava 2:1
Darko Tasevski started for Levski and played until the 56th minute when he was replaced by Sjoerd Ars. Tasevski started in the playmaker position for Levski in a 4-2-3-1 formation but had a subpar game before he was substituted early in the 2nd half. Ars, who came on for Tasevski, actually scored the game winning goal for Levski in the second minute of stoppage time in the 90th minute.

UEFA Europa League, Third qualifying round, Olimpija Ljubljana – Austria Wien 1:1
Dragan Cadikovski started on the bench for Olimpija Ljubljana before he entered the game in the 58th minute replacing Adnan Bešić. Two minutes after Cadikovski came on, Olimpija Ljubljana was able to score the equalizing goal but the game finished 1:1 and the return leg will decide the fixture.
